ERLEDIGT
NEIN
NEIN
ANTWORTEN
1
1
ZUGRIFFE
1207
1207
EMPFEHLEN
-
Hallo zusammen, ich schon wieder,
und zwar hab ich momentan das Problem, dass Threads nicht richtig geschlossen werden.
Ich habe einen Thread, welcher mit öffnen der Netzwerkverbindung gestartet wird, und so lange laufen soll bis die Netzwerkverbindung unterbrochen wird. Dabei wird mit Networkstream.Read(...) auf ankommende Daten gewartet.
Wie kann ich den Thread am sinnvollsten unterbrechen?
Thread.Abort() schien mir nicht nur zu brutal, sondern funktioniert auch nicht.
Irgendwie muss die warterei auf Read ein Ende haben, wenn die Verbindung geschlossen wird. Aber wie?
Von ReadAsync möchte ich mal absehen - damit hab ich mich noch nicht beschäftigt.
Muss ja auch so irgendwie gehen...
lgGeändert von Klein0r (22.04.09 um 14:03 Uhr)
-
22.05.09 23:28 #2
- Registriert seit
- Apr 2005
- Beiträge
- 9
öhmn mal ne blöde frage, du schließt den networkstream aber schon, wenn du mit dem "warten auf daten" aufhören willst oder
Ähnliche Themen
-
Variable aus einem Thread ansprechen
Von ceene im Forum Enterprise Java (JEE, J2EE, Spring & Co.)Antworten: 2Letzter Beitrag: 02.12.09, 12:51 -
ListView.Items.Add() aus einem Thread?
Von lordfritte im Forum .NET Windows FormsAntworten: 3Letzter Beitrag: 26.04.08, 17:08 -
Probleme mit einem einfachen Thread
Von AKST im Forum JavaAntworten: 10Letzter Beitrag: 05.07.04, 21:01 -
c# NetworkStream - Serialisierung
Von Cenk im Forum .NET ArchivAntworten: 1Letzter Beitrag: 20.08.03, 14:39





Zitieren
Login





